1802 Mo. F.T eight reales, one of a type struck 1791-1808. Assayer FT is noted for 1801-03. 
Mintages are not known, condition seldom seen with a strong original detail. Most of these 
coins are in really poor grade, a historical early Colony period coin. 
These colonial period coins circulated freely in the many New 
World colonies of Spain and many were lost in shipwrecks. 
Weight: 27 Grams, Fineness: .896 Silver, Diameter; 39 mm, Mintage; Unknown.
